You may want to pull the oil out when it's not running....to keep it warm (the way Bush Pilots used to drain the oil from their planes up in Alaska), then add it just before you run it.
A PITA for sure, but at least you'd know it was gonna start, and be lubricated properly.
I'd think, if you did that, you could probably use the normal weight oil....but agree with Dave, you may want to check with Mfgr.
